Transaction 69d9741f32e2a760ae6fdcdf630acee7073255e892ffa46c3e94f41216ed5dba

33 Input
2 Outputs
  • 69d9741f32e2a760ae6fdcdf630acee7073255e892ffa46c3e94f41216ed5dba:0
  • value  549046
    address  35HzThvdzYVQWnZN33EFzk5y5aZfhGSVwG
  • 69d9741f32e2a760ae6fdcdf630acee7073255e892ffa46c3e94f41216ed5dba:1
  • value  1720910413
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s